The Junior League of Dallas Lifetime Achievement Award

As a celebration of the 105th Anniversary of the Junior League of Dallas, the Lifetime Achievement Award for excellence in voluntarism and community leadership will be announced in June and presented at the 2026-2027 Milestones Luncheon. This distinguished award is presented to a Sustaining member of the Junior League of Dallas who has been a catalyst for positive community change and who has consistently demonstrated leadership skills and vision.

Sustaining and Active JLD members may nominate women whom they feel are worthy of consideration. Nominators are asked to submit names of League members who have lived the JLD mission through their JLD service and beyond, demonstrated outstanding leadership, and have made a lasting impact on our community.

The recipient of the Lifetime Achievement Award will be a Sustaining member of the Junior League of Dallas who meets the following criteria:

  • Exemplifies JLD principles of commitment and community leadership, multiculturalism, vision, and innovation
  • Is a role model, mentor, catalyst, and risk-taker making an exceptional and lasting contribution to the community
  • Takes a    comprehensive   approach   to    community   problem-solving, advocacy, coalition building, direct service, and public education
  • Faces obstacles, takes risks, and devotes the necessary time to pursue her vision
  • Takes the time to understand and develop the technical skills and knowledge required to reach the vision
  • Brings others into her vision
  • Is creating local impact with national/international implications
